Where this album fits
- Career context
- By the time 'Magnetic North' was released in 2007, Hopesfall was transitioning from their earlier post-hardcore sound to a more atmospheric approach. This album followed their 2005 release 'Ghosts', marking a significant evolution in their musical style as they embraced more melodic elements and introspective themes.
